About the role

The Assistant Construction Manager role is a position within the WSP program management team supporting CTDOT during construction of the Walk Bridge Replacement Program in Norwalk, CT. This position provides day-to-day technical, coordination, and documentation support to the Construction Managers and assists with integrating construction-phase information into program reporting, change management, and issue tracking processes.

Responsibilities

  • Assist with preparation of monthly and quarterly program reports related to construction progress, issues, risks, and schedule activities.
  • Prepare draft technical memoranda, briefing materials, and presentations to support CTDOT and Program Management needs.
  • Record, prepare, and distribute meeting agendas and minutes for construction-related meetings.
  • Track action items and follow-up items to support issue resolution.
  • Aid in the development of construction-phase cost estimates related to Design Issue Change Orders (DICOs) and potential changes.
  • Maintain logs and tracking tools for DICOs, potential changes, and other construction-related items.
  • Coordinate with Construction Managers to update potential change logs and provide summary information for program reporting.
  • Support coordination between the Construction Managers, CEI staff, designers, and program management team members.
  • Aid in organizing and tracking design-construction interface issues requiring follow-up or resolution.
  • Support third-party coordination efforts (railroad, utilities, other agencies) by preparing correspondence, tracking responses, and organizing information.
  • Coordinate with Project Controls staff to support construction-related schedule, cost, and risk reporting.
  • Aid in tracking emerging issues, risks, and mitigation actions identified during construction meetings.
  • Maintain and update the program Commitment Tracking Log and support coordination and reporting of commitment and closure.
  • Help organize and maintain issue resolution logs, commitment tracking inputs, and construction-related program records.

About WSP

WSP USA is the U.S. operating company of WSP, one of the world's leading engineering and professional services firms. Dedicated to serving local communities, we are engineers, planners, technical experts, strategic advisors and construction management professionals. WSP USA designs lasting solutions in the buildings, transportation, energy, water and environment markets. With more than 15,000 employees in over 300 offices across the U.S., we partner with our clients to help communities prosper.
